Full Guide to Install Windows OS on Apple Silicon Mac

Christina
Written byChristinaUpdated on Dec 18, 2025
Gerhard Chou
Approved byGerhard Chou

Table of Contents

PAGE CONTENT:

Apple's shift from Intel processors to Apple Silicon (M1, M2, M3, M4, and M5 chips) introduced dramatic changes to Mac performance, power efficiency, and architecture. However, this transition also disrupted legacy workflows—especially those that depended on dual-booting Windows through Boot Camp. If you're an Apple Silicon Mac user who want to run Windows on your machine, this article walks you through the current options, limitations, and step-by-step instructions for using virtualization and cloud-based methods.

install Windows OS on Apple Silicon Mac

Whether you're a developer needing Windows-exclusive tools or a gamer exploring cross-platform titles, you'll find the most practical solutions right here to install Windows OS on Apple Silicon Mac.

Can You Install Windows OS on Apple Silicon Mac?

On Intel-based Macs, Boot Camp allowed users to install Windows natively. Unfortunately, Boot Camp is not supported on Apple Silicon Macs. Apple's new chip architecture (based on ARM, not x86) means traditional native Windows installations are no longer possible.

Microsoft's official ARM version of Windows isn't generally licensed for direct Mac installation either. However, virtualization platforms now offer reliable ways to run Windows on Apple Silicon Macs, particularly via Parallels Desktop or UTM.

System Requirements

Before proceeding, ensure your setup meets the following requirements:

  • Mac model: Any Apple Silicon-based Mac (M1, M2, M3, M4, M5, etc.).
  • macOS version: macOS Ventura or later is recommended.
  • RAM: Minimum 8GB (16GB or more preferred for smoother Windows experience).
  • Storage: At least 30–50GB of free disk space.
  • Virtualization software: Parallels Desktop (paid) or UTM (free).
  • Windows version: Windows 11 ARM ISO or VHDX from Microsoft Insider Preview.

How to Install and Run Windows on Apple Silicon Mac?

To run Windows OS on Apple Silicon Mac, you can install the system on Mac directly via virtualization tools or directly run Windows via cloud service. Here we will introduce each method in detail.

Option 1: Install Windows on M-Chip Mac Using Parallels Desktop

What Is Parallels Desktop? Parallels Desktop is a premium virtualization software optimized for Apple Silicon. It allows you to run Windows 11 ARM in a virtual machine on your Mac without rebooting. It is officially authorized by Microsoft to run Windows 11 on M-series Macs and offers seamless integration with macOS.

Pros

  • Smooth performance
  • Direct support for Windows 11 ARM
  • Easy setup wizard
  • Official Microsoft support

Cons

  • Paid software (subscription model)

How to Install Windows with Parallels

Step 1: Download and install Parallels Desktop

Go to https://www.parallels.com and download the latest version of Parallels Desktop for Mac. Install it like any other macOS app.

Step 2: Get Windows 11 ARM Version

Parallels automates this step. On launch, it detects that you're using Apple Silicon and offers to download Windows 11 ARM Insider Preview directly from Microsoft.

You may need to sign in with a Microsoft account to join the Windows Insider Program.

install Windows OS on Apple Silicon Mac

Step 3: Create a Virtual Machine for Windows

Parallels automatically creates a new VM, downloads the ISO, and begins setup. Just follow the wizard.

install Windows OS on Apple Silicon Mac

Step 4: Configure the Virtual Machine

  • Allocate 4–8GB of RAM and 2–4 CPU cores depending on your Mac's specs.
  • You can also set disk size and integration options with macOS.

Step 5: Finish Installation

Parallels installs Windows 11 ARM, sets up drivers, and lets you log in.

install Windows OS on Apple Silicon Mac

You're done! You can now launch Windows from your Mac Dock like any other app.

Bonus: Gaming Setup (Optional)

If you want to play lightweight or older Windows games:

  • Set the VM to "Games only" during setup
  • Allocate at least 8GB RAM
  • Enable DirectX and OpenGL support in Parallels settings
  • Use a game controller via Bluetooth or USB passthrough

Note that graphics-intensive games like Call of Duty or Cyberpunk 2077 won't perform well due to virtualization and ARM architecture limits.

Why Parallels is Ideal for Most Users

  • Beginner-friendly: No command line or manual ISO downloads needed
  • Official Microsoft support: You're not hacking around licensing restrictions
  • Fast performance: Optimized for Apple Silicon
  • Excellent integration: Feels like part of macOS

Performance and Use Cases

Parallels provides near-native speed for everyday tasks:

  • Microsoft Office
  • Visual Studio Code
  • Browsers and productivity tools

However, graphics-intensive games or apps requiring x86 64-bit architecture may not perform well due to ARM emulation limits.

Option 2: Install Windows on Apple Silicon Mac Using UTM

What Is UTM? UTM is a free, open-source virtualization software built on QEMU, designed specifically for macOS, including Apple Silicon. It allows you to run Windows ARM using VHDX files.

Pros

  • Completely free
  • Customizable settings
  • No subscription required

Cons

  • More complex setup than Parallels
  • Limited GPU acceleration
  • Slightly lower performance

How to Install Windows with UTM:

Step 1: Download and Install UTM

Visit https://mac.getutm.app/ and download the latest version. Install it on your Mac.

Step 2: Download Windows 11 ARM VHDX

Go to Microsoft's Insider Preview downloads and download the Windows 11 ARM64 VHDX.

Requires free Microsoft account and joining the Insider Preview Program.

Step 3: Create New Virtual Machine in UTM

  1. Open UTM and click "+" to create a new VM. Choose the "Virualize" option.

    install Windows OS on Apple Silicon Mac

  2. To choose an operation system → "Windows."

    install Windows OS on Apple Silicon Mac

  3. Select the VHDX file you downloaded.

    install Windows OS on Apple Silicon Mac

  4. Configure the settings for RAM, CPU and disk space.

    install Windows OS on Apple Silicon Mac

Step 4: Install and Boot Windows

Click "Play" to boot your VM. Windows will complete setup as normal.

install Windows OS on Apple Silicon Mac

Step 5: Install SPICE Tools (Optional but Recommended)

SPICE tools improve performance and enable clipboard sharing, file transfers, and better resolution. You can find these under UTM's VM settings.

Performance and Limitations

UTM is ideal for lightweight tasks like:

  • Browsing
  • Document editing
  • Basic Windows apps

However, there's no GPU acceleration, and performance lags behind Parallels. It's best suited for occasional or hobbyist Windows use.

Option 3: Run Windows on Apple Silicon Mac via Cloud Services

If local virtualization doesn't suit your needs, you can run Windows in the cloud. You don't need to install Windows OS on Mac. There are some available options:

A. Windows 365

Microsoft's subscription service that delivers a full Windows PC over the cloud.

B. Azure Virtual Desktop

Ideal for businesses and IT teams wanting to manage multiple users.

C. Amazon WorkSpaces or Shadow

Third-party services offering cloud PCs that run Windows OS.

Pros

  • No installation or virtualization required
  • Access from any Mac or browser
  • High-speed internet = smooth experience

Cons

  • Monthly cost
  • Performance depends on connection
  • Limited customization

Limitations of Running Windows on Apple Silicon Mac

Despite viable workarounds, there are a few limitations worth noting:

1. No Boot Camp (Native Install)

There's no dual-boot option like on Intel Macs.

2. App Compatibility

Windows ARM supports ARM-native apps, and many x64 apps run via emulation. But some older x86 apps and drivers may fail to work.

3. Gaming Challenges

  • Most modern games are built for x64.
  • Emulated graphics performance is subpar.
  • No DirectX 12 Ultimate support via virtualization.

4. Hardware Peripheral Support

Certain USB dongles, printers, or legacy software may not work properly due to missing drivers.

Tips for the Best Experience

  • Use Parallels if performance and simplicity matter most.
  • Try UTM if you're on a budget or enjoy tweaking settings.
  • Opt for cloud Windows if you only need occasional access.
  • Assign enough RAM and CPU cores in your virtual machine.
  • Use an external SSD if internal storage is limited.
  • Keep your macOS and virtualization apps up to date for optimal compatibility.

FAQs about Installing Windows OS on Apple Silicon Mac

1. Can I run x86 Windows apps on M1/M2/M3/M4/M5 Mac?

Yes, Windows ARM includes x86 emulation. However, apps requiring x64 emulation may have limited compatibility or degraded performance.

2. Is Windows 11 ARM version free to use?

The Insider Preview is free, but for full activation, you need a valid and paid license key.

3. Which is better to run Windows on Mac: Parallels or UTM?

Parallels is better for performance and user experience. UTM is free and great for advanced users or testing.

4. Can I dual-boot Windows and macOS on M-chip Macs?

No, dual-booting via Boot Camp is no longer available on Apple Silicon Macs.

Conclusion

Apple Silicon changed the game for Mac performance but also changed how Windows runs on these devices. While traditional dual-booting is off the table, Parallels Desktop, UTM, and cloud-based solutions provide reliable ways to access Windows on your M1, M2, M3, M4, or M5-chip Mac.

If you need Windows frequently or require performance, go with Parallels. If you're okay with a more manual and free approach, UTM is your go-to. And if you rarely need Windows and prefer not to install anything locally, a cloud service may be your best bet.

By choosing the right method based on your needs and following the steps in this guide, you can comfortably bridge the gap between macOS and Windows on your Apple Silicon Mac.

logo stage

Donemax Disk Clone for Mac

An award-winning disk cloning program to help Mac users clone HDD/SSD/external device. It also can create full bootable clone backup for Macs.

Christina
Contributing Writer

Christina

Christina is the senior editor of Donemax software who has worked in the company for 4+ years. She mainly writes the guides and solutions about data erasure, data transferring, data recovery and disk cloning to help users get the most out of their Windows and Mac. She likes to travel, enjoy country music and play games in her spare time.

Gerhard Chou
Editor in chief

Gerhard Chou

In order to effectively solve the problems for our customers, every article and troubleshooting solution published on our website has been strictly tested and practiced. Our editors love researching and using computers and testing software, and are willing to help computer users with their problems